Overview

Mecalift specializes in innovative materials handling equipment for ports, railroads, road transports, and diverse fields of industry. We’re committed to helping our customers worldwide to handle materials even in the most demanding conditions. We focus on their needs and operating conditions in the design and manufacturing of our products. Mecalift uses Meclift™, a well-known and established name, as a brand name in its marketing and communication. The Meclift™ range of products and services responds to several different material handling needs. Our Meclift™ Variable Reach Trucks cover lifting capacity ranges from 16 tons to 50 tons. Our strength in supporting our customers resides in an innovative business culture, which provides a fruitful base to successful R&D and individual solutions. “Our passion is to facilitate the operations of our clients by offering competitive solutions, being proactive, and responding to requests swiftly.” -Mecalift To enable diverse utilization of the Meclift™ machinery, we listen to our customers when designing new lifting attachments to our products. Doing this allows us to meet the individual needs of cargo and other material handling companies. That is why also small production volumes are interesting to us. Customers operating in a wide range of industry fields in approximately 30 countries in Africa, Asia, Europe, North America, Oceania, and South America are operating Meclift™ machinery. The roots of Mecalift, an independent family-owned company, go back to the year 1981. Operation under the current name was founded in 1993. From 2019 the company is owned by Lännen MCE Oy, Sign Systems Finland Oy, and Credos Oy. Chairman of the board is Mr. Timo Huttunen. Other members of the board are Juhani Eskelinen, Jarmo Viitala, and Janne Kalliomäki. Janne Kalliomäki also works as the CEO of the company.
